Customer Personas

Customer personas are detailed, semi-fictional representations of ideal customers based on real data and research, used to guide product development, marketing, and user experience design. They typically include demographic information, behaviors, goals, and pain points to humanize target audiences and align teams around user needs. This methodology helps organizations create more effective and user-centric solutions by focusing on specific user segments rather than generic assumptions.

🧊Why learn Customer Personas?

Developers should learn and use customer personas when building software or digital products to ensure features and interfaces meet actual user requirements, reducing wasted effort and improving adoption rates. It is particularly valuable in agile and user-centered design processes, such as during sprint planning, user story creation, or A/B testing, to prioritize development tasks that address real user problems. For example, in a SaaS application, personas can guide decisions on feature sets, onboarding flows, and accessibility considerations.
